“Fakes” in Museums

Fakes
Fakes in the Musées Royaux d’Art et d’Historie, Brussels. Photo: TMK, July 2006.

It’s not all museums that are courageous enough or even willing to stand by the fakes in their collections. The Brussels archaeological museum is a wonderful exception to the rule. Here, the “fakes” acquired over the years as genuine antiques are exhibited in all their glory in a special glass case!
